Er... VOB files are DVD format, by definition. If you've got a set of VOBs and IFOs, you've already got an authored project; all that needs to be done is to burn them to DVD. (Unless they're a rip from a dual-layer disc and thus too large to fit on a single-layer DVD, in which case you use something like DVDShrink to transcode them down to size.)
If you've got VOBs, but no IFOs, then... that would be a bit odd, to say the least. Where did these files come from, exactly? -
